Output f58b38c3448055496798652561a2dc91dd37c6a988b62df7c83b4a9968205571:0

value
26427271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d88c8214ad6832ad5a49c195fe89221bb04eaa1 OP_EQUAL
address
MC3vVpqxYzSCZsV9ojYazuELnvxGABSYMx
transaction
f58b38c3448055496798652561a2dc91dd37c6a988b62df7c83b4a9968205571
spent
true